NCP4422T by Onsemi

NCP4422T by Onsemi is a MOSFET Gate Driver with 18V max supply voltage, 9A peak current limit, and 0.08us turn-on/off time. Ideal for commercial applications requiring high side drivers in CMOS technology with flange mount package style.

Overview

Discover the NCP4422T by Onsemi, a high-quality MOSFET gate driver that offers exceptional performance and reliability. With its advanced technology and commercial-grade temperature grade, this rectangular flange mount device is perfect for a wide range of applications. From power supplies to motor control, this product ensures efficient operation with a fast turn-on/off time and nominal output peak current limit of 9A. Trust Onsemi's expertise in semiconductor manufacturing and experience the value and benefits that the NCP4422T brings to your projects.

Manufacturer Highlights

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
